4 You are to launch a rocket, from just above the ground, with one of the following initial velocity vectors: (1) v 20i + 70j, (2) Vo = -201 + 70j. (3) Vo = 20i - 70j. (4) Vo = -20i - 70j. In your coordinate system, x runs along level ground and y increases upward. (a) Rank the vectors according to the launch speed of the projectile, greatest first. (b) Rank the vectors according to the time of flight of the projectile, greatest first.
